Immigration Services Explained
Syed Afaq Hussain Bukhari, a Regulated Canadian Immigration Consultant in Coquitlam, specializes in a wide array of immigration pathways designed to help individuals and families achieve their Canadian residency goals. Through the Express Entry system, he expertly navigates the complexities of federal programs like the Federal Skilled Worker, Canadian Experience Class, and Federal Skilled Trades, ensuring eligible candidates maximize their Comprehensive Ranking System (CRS) scores. For those pursuing province-specific routes, Syed offers tailored guidance on Provincial Nominee Programs (PNPs), connecting clients with opportunities that align with provincial labor market needs. Families seeking reunification benefit from his in-depth expertise in Family Sponsorship, where he assists in facilitating spousal, parent, and dependent child sponsorship applications. Syed also supports temporary residents with Work Permits and Study Permits, providing clarity on employer-specific work authorization and the transition from study to permanent residency. Entrepreneurs and business professionals can rely on his knowledge of Business Immigration programs, including pathways for investors and self-employed individuals. Delivering meticulous attention to complex immigration requirements, Syed helps clients understand timelines, documentation, and eligibility criteria, empowering them to make informed decisions at every stage of their journey toward Canadian residency or citizenship.
